Typical Uses of Polypropylene in Hospitals and Labs

Polypropylene is used to manufacture a broad range of medical consumables commonly found in hospitals, laboratories, and clinics. Items such as test tubes, centrifuge tubes, surgical trays, and IV connectors are often made from this material due to its reliable performance.

In laboratories, polypropylene labware provides a practical option for sample handling and storage. Its low water absorption and chemical resistance help preserve the integrity of samples. In clinical use, syringes and medication dispensers made from polypropylene are often selected for their transparency and ease of production.

Another advantage is the material’s ability to be molded into complex shapes without compromising structural strength. This allows manufacturers to create precise components required for specific procedures. Additionally, it can be colored or marked clearly, assisting in product identification.

Because polypropylene is suitable for both manual and automated processes, it fits well into modern healthcare environments. Its adaptability helps meet the growing demand for safe, efficient, and cost-effective medical supplies.
